#bc7c18 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c7c18 is composed of 73.7% red, 48.6%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 36.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 41.6%. #bc7c18 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ff830 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#bc7c18 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bc7c18 has RGB values of R:188, G:124,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.87,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12352536.

Hex triplet bc7c18 #bc7c18
RGB Decimal 188, 124, 24 rgb(188,124,24)
RGB Percent 73.7, 48.6, 9.4 rgb(73.7%,48.6%,9.4%)
CMYK 0, 34, 87, 26
HSL 36.6°, 77.4, 41.6 hsl(36.6,77.4%,41.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 36.6°, 87.2, 73.7
Web Safe cc6600 #cc6600
CIE-LAB 57.245, 17.425, 58.48
XYZ 28.112, 25.175, 4.243
xyY 0.489, 0.438, 25.175
CIE-LCH 57.245, 61.021, 73.408
CIE-LUV 57.245, 52.75, 54.404
Hunter-Lab 50.174, 12.207, 30.108
Binary 10111100, 01111100, 00011000

Shades and Tints of #bc7c18

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0902 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bc7c18 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#848484 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8f826e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a08f27 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b38820 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c47a82 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#aa8821 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b6841d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c17b5b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
